To find the fraction for 70cm of 1m, you need to remember that 1 meter is equal to 100 centimeters. Therefore, the fraction would be 70/100, which simplifies to 7/10 when reduced to its simplest form. This means that 70cm is equivalent to 7/10 or 0.7 of a meter.
There are .7m in 700mm. You can find this by seeing that 10mm = 1cm. This means that 700mm = 70cm. Then you can see that 100cm = 1m. This means that 70cm = .7m.
